The Benefits and Challenges of Retiring in Argentina
Benefits of Retiring in Argentina
One of the primary benefits of retiring in Argentina is the country’s affordable cost of living. With the favorable exchange rate, retirees from countries like the United States, Canada, or Europe can stretch their retirement savings further. Housing, food, transportation, and healthcare costs are considerably lower compared to many other countries, making Argentina an ideal destination for those seeking a comfortable retirement on a budget.
Another advantage of retiring in Argentina is the country’s stunning landscapes and diverse climate. From the breathtaking Andes mountains to the picturesque Patagonia region and the vibrant city life in Buenos Aires, Argentina offers retirees a wide range of options when it comes to choosing their ideal retirement location. Whether you prefer the tranquility of a small town or the excitement of a bustling city, Argentina has something for everyone.
Challenges of Retiring in Argentina
While retiring in Argentina offers numerous benefits, it is important to be aware of the challenges that may arise. One of the key challenges is the language barrier. Spanish is the official language in Argentina, and while many locals speak English, it is still highly recommended to have some basic knowledge of Spanish to navigate daily life effectively. Taking language classes or hiring a local tutor can help retirees overcome this hurdle and fully immerse themselves in the local culture.
Another challenge is navigating the complex bureaucracy and legal procedures that may be involved in retiring in Argentina. It is essential to thoroughly research the visa requirements, healthcare options, and tax implications to ensure a smooth transition. Seeking professional assistance, such as hiring an immigration lawyer or financial advisor specializing in international retirement, can greatly simplify the process.
